My understanding is that Roland Gumpert heads the company GMG. He was a WRC champion and ran Audi's program successfully for some period of time -- hence the Audi powerplant. GMG is located in Germany. Top-power model is like 650hp. Car only weighs like 2300 pounds. He's a component builder (like many others) who uses the best components readily available to produce the car. I am not sure the car is supercar status along with the likes of the Spyker, Ascari, Koenigsegg, Saleen, SSC Aero, Leblanc, and Ford GT -- let alone the MC12, CLK DTM, SLR, or Pagani, Ferrari, Lamborghini, and Porsche. I don't think the fit and finish and roadability are there. More in the vein of a track car like the Ultima, Noble, and Lotus Exige I think. My information is that they can be had starting at about EUR 120K and running up to about EUR 200K for the top performance model fully decked-out.
I haven't confirmed it yet, but this month's Dubai auto show may have been their first and/or latest public display and promotion, and I think that that is where those photos came from.
The car is interesting though...and I'm sure that I'll go check it out....
